Osteopenia
Brief summary
Recent studies have shown that inhibition of Aquaporine-9 channels may ameliorate the bone degradation process. Pro-bone is an AQ - 9 channels inhibitor. This study is design to evaluate the safety of Pro-bone.
Interventions
500 mg Capsules of Pro-Bone twice daily

Eligibility
Inclusion criteria
* BMD as measured by DEXA at screening, should range between (-1)to (-2.5) SD from normal values. * At least 12 months of spontaneous amenorrhea or at least 6 weeks postsurgical bilateral oophorectomy with or without hysterectomy. * Study participants not taking estrogen alone or estrogen/progestin containing drug products. * Study participants not taking any anti-osteoporosis treatment for at list one year. * The following washout periods should be before baseline assessments are made for subjects previously on estrogen alone or estrogen/progestin containing products: 1. 8 weeks or longer for any prior use of estrogen and/or progestin products. 2. 6 months or longer for prior progestin injectable drug therapy. 3. Women between 45 and 65 years (inclusive) of age. 4. BMI 22-30 (inclusive) 5. Non-smoking (by declaration) for a period of at least 6 months. 6. Subjects able to adhere to the visit schedule and protocol requirements and be available to complete the study. * Subjects who provide written informed consent.
Exclusion criteria
* Women have documentation of a positive screening mammogram (obtained at screening or within 9 months of study enrolment) or abnormal clinical breast examination prior to enrolment in clinical studies. * Known history of significant medical disorder, which in the investigator's judgment contraindicates administration of the study medications. * Any clinically significant abnormality, upon physical examination or in clinical laboratory test, at screening visit. * Known history of drug or alcohol abuse according to participant declaration at screening visit. * Any acute medical situation (e.g. acute infection) within 48 hours of study start, which is considered of significance by the Principal Investigator. * Subjects who are non-cooperative or unwilling to sign consent form.
